Detection and Application of Dispersion Threshold in Double Component System

Abstract: In this article the dispersion of CuO,NiO on the HZSM-5 support was discussed bv XRDmethod;Spontaneous dispersion tendency of CuO is more obvious than that of NiO.Their dispersion degrees are different when proportions of CuO and NiO are different.In case where the proportion is 0.6423,the dispersion threshold is the largest. This threshold 1s 0.12 g CuO/g HZSM-5 which corresponds to the optimum proportion of CuO and NiO.when the catalyst is used to synthesize n-butylamine,
